Job Title: Front Desk Assistant/Optometric Assistant
Reports To: Office Manager/Chief Optometrist
Summary: This position is 50% administrative and 50% clinical. The first part of the position is running and managing the front desk area. The second part is assisting the doctor work up the patients.

Language Ability:
Ability to read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als. Ability to communicate efficiently and effectively to patient and patient’s families.
Math Ability:
Ability to calculate figures and distances that relate to basic optics as well as basic math functions for collecting money
Reasoning Ability:
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out detailed but uninvolved written or oral instructions. Ability to deal with problems involving a few concrete variables in standardized situations.
Computer Skills:
To perform this job successfully, an individual should have knowledge in computer skills; as many programs and equipment are computer based.
Education/Experience:
An associate’s degree or 2 year college degree is preferred, or a high school diploma and at least one year related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ience.
